SALEM (WKBN) -- A Salem woman has died and a passenger has been hospitalized after a car drove into a building Saturday afternoon.
A release from the Ohio State Highway Patrol says the car crashed into Perry Township Garage on South Ellsworth Avenue just before 4 p.m.
The driver, identified as Jennifer Engle, 56, of Salem, drove her Ford Fiesta off the left side of the roadway, crossing Snyder Avenue and crashing into the building, the release says.
Engle was pronounced dead at the scene and the passenger was airlifted to St. Elizabeth's Hospital in Youngstown with "serious injuries," according to OSHP.
The passenger's current condition is unknown.
The building sustained "heavy damage" to the exterior and interior walls, and a Freightliner dump truck that was parked inside also sustained damage. The building was unoccupied at the time of the crash.
OSHP does not believe that drugs or alcohol were involved in the crash, but they do say they suspect that Engle may have experienced a medical emergency prior to the crash.
The crash is still under investigation.
Assisting agencies on the scene included OSHP, the Columbiana County Sheriff's Office, Perry Township Police and Fire, Stat MedEvac, EMT Ambulance and Sinsley's Towing.
